Unlike open-source CNC control platforms, PlanetCNC operates on a proprietary hardware-software hybrid model.
The license is Controller Restricted . This means it is tied specifically to the unique serial number of your USB controller board.

Unlike older systems that rely on the dated Parallel (LPT) port, Planet CNC provides a modern, robust, and fully integrated hardware-and-software package. This complete system, known as the PlanetCNC TNG (The Next Generation), acts as a dedicated link between your computer and the motor drivers of your CNC machine.
By properly licensing your Planet CNC controller, you unlock full TNG software functionality, including advanced features, support for advanced machine types, and unrestricted G-code execution.
